Your approach may work; you could avoid the enumeration of the elements in the grammar by: - creating an instance of XMLGrammarPoolImpl - instanciating the DOMBuilder using createDOMBuilder(MODE_SYNCHRONOUS, NULL, XMLPlatformUtils::fgMemoryManager, grammarPool) - using grammar->getElemDecl(grammarPool->getURIStringPool()->getId("parlayx_cal l_notification_local_xsd"), "handleBusy", NULL, Grammar::TOP_LEVEL_SCOPE) Another option is building an XSModel using grammarPool->getXSModel(). Then, use XSModel::getElementDeclaration("handleBusy", "parlayx_call_notification_local_xsd") and examine the element definition. This because the informations stored in the SchemaGrammar object are optimized to validate the data, while the XSModel data structure tries to keep all the informations in the schema (including annotations).
